There was a little confusion with our room when we arrived, however the staff were very helpful and understanding. They showed us the room that wasn't going to be ready until 9, but offered to book another room for us. We ended up leaving our bags at reception and exploring the city before coming back to a freshly renovated apartment which was spotless and very nice inside. My friend was feeling sick and the staff were extremely helpful, going above and beyond their duty.

It's hard to find something bad to say about that place. Maybe the age of the building, probably because of it's location (the heart of the old town) , that gives us a bad first impression. But that's it. It's located at a few minutes by walk to the Charles Bridge. The staff speaks good english and are very receiving. The breakfast (we had to pay 10 extra euros for it) was very nice also. But the best of all is the apartment itself. It's huge! It even has a pool table in it. Very recommended.

Very near the old town and Charels bridge. can go shopping for souvinors and have a drink easily in the near.The heating is perfect. Very nice and clean kitchen where you can cook and eat quietly. But a bit far away from the metro station and not so easily to find. The hotel is in the opper floor and the sign does\'t show it clearly. We share the bathroom with other guests and we hear people talking a shower in the middle of the night.
